This versatile plant can be grown as a vegetable and eaten like other greens or, if allowed to flower and go to seed, mustard seeds can be harvested and used as a spice in cooking or ground into a popular condiment. Mustard seeds can be a rich source of minerals such as calcium, magnesium, phosphorus, and potassium, according to the usda.along with this, it may be a good source of dietary folate and vitamin a as well.
